SANITOR-1st Shift
PRINCIPLE ACCOUNTABILITIES
• Maintain general plant cleanliness related to the Master Sanitation Schedule. This includes cleaning walls, ceilings, fans, lights, and floors.
• Clean and operate all product fillers, tanks, piping, and other related processing equipment.
• Clean all production equipment related to operation of lines including coolers and can tracks.
• Maintain outside grounds and outside equipment.
• Safely and correctly use chemicals and proper procedures to clean and sanitize.
• Adhere to Red Gold policies, rules and regulations, including GMP’s and safety.
• Work as a team player with members of the crew and others in the plant.
